In simple terms, a 5th wheel plate is a large, usually flat, metal plate mounted on a truck’s chassis. It acts kind of like a pivot or a mechanical “hinge” between a tractor unit and its trailer. The trailer’s kingpin locks into this plate, allowing the trailer to articulate and turn while remaining firmly attached.
This engineering marvel might seem basic, but it’s evolved into a highly specialized, precisely machined component often made of hardened steel or composite materials. It’s crucial not just in commercial trucking but also in military logistics, disaster relief convoys, and even mobile hospital setups, where fast deployment and stable transport are non-negotiable.
Given the stress these plates endure, durability isn’t just a buzzword — it’s life or death on the road. Most 5th wheel plates are constructed from high-grade carbon steel or alloys. This ensures they resist cracking, deformation, and wear. I’ve noticed that many engineers prefer plates treated with anti-corrosion coatings, especially for use in salty or humid climates.
The gap between the plate and the kingpin is meticulously calculated. Too tight, and it causes wear or binding; too loose, and it leads to dangerous trailer sway. Modern manufacturing and quality assurance ensure precision fitment, improving safety and extending lifetime service.
Effective lubrication systems are integral since these mechanical joints experience constant friction. Lubrication reduces wear and prevents overheating. Some plates now come with grease reservoirs or automated lubrication features to ease operational burdens, which is a neat innovation.
For fleet managers, cost isn’t just upfront purchase price but total cost of ownership. A robust 5th wheel plate reduces downtime and maintenance expenses, ultimately saving money. Also, regional availability often determines which plates are used, sometimes forcing compromises in quality or efficiency.
Different truck and trailer types need specific plate sizes and locking mechanisms. The ability to scale and interchange plates across vehicle types improves operational flexibility — a must-have feature for logistics companies that handle varied cargo.
Mini takeaway: Durability, fit, lubrication, cost, and compatibility aren’t just technical specs — they shape daily trucking outcomes from safety to expenses.

| Feature | Specification |
|---|---|
| Material | High carbon steel, heat-treated |
| Plate Dimensions | 560 mm x 540 mm x 20 mm thickness |
| Load Capacity | up to 30,000 kg dynamic load |
| Finish | Powder-coated, corrosion resistant |
| Lubrication | Manual grease fittings or optional automatic |
| Compatibility | Standard kingpin sizes (2 in, 3.5 in) |
